R931 VLD is a 1998 Rover 114 in Blue with a 1,396cc petrol engine. This vehicle has been through 12 MOT tests with a personal pass rate of 66.7%.
Across all 1998 Rover 114 models, the average MOT pass rate is 65.8% with a typical mileage of 44,876 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Rover 114 fails its MOT is seat belt anchorage prescribed area is excessively corroded, accounting for 11,635 recorded failures. If you're considering buying R931 VLD, it's worth having these areas checked by a mechanic before committing.
The Rover 114 typically stays on UK roads for around 31 years. At 28 years old, this Rover 114 is approaching the upper end of the typical lifespan for this model.
